摘要
A new series of 14-20-membered tetraamide macrocyclic complexes, [ML1]Cl2-[ML8]Cl2, of cobalt(II), nickel(II), copper(II) and zinc(II) have been prepared via the template condensation of dicarboxylic acid with primary diamines. All the complexes are soluble in most polar solvents. The complexes have been characterized by IR. H-1 NMR, mass, ESR and electronic spectral studies and magnetic measurements. A square planar geometry for the complexes, [ML(n)]2+, where M = Ni(II) and Cu(II), or a tetrahedral geometry for M = Co(II) and Zn(II) have been assigned. The electrical conductivity data in DMSO are as expected for 1 : 2 electrolytes.
